Example what a stock character is. Give an example.
A simple, straightforward character who never changes and never learns. Repeated all over. Similar to a stereotype. Example: hopeless lover
Explain a stylized movement. Give an example.
A small, simple action to indicate something much bigger. Example: walking in a circle --> going on a long journey.
